Abstract

See full text

Various solutions for wireless sensing in integrated sensing and communications (ISAC) system are described. An apparatus (e.g., a receiver node) may receive one or more first reference signals (RSs) based on a first sensing RS configuration, and perform a sensing of a target object based on the first RSs. Then, the apparatus may receive one or more second RSs based on a second sensing RS configuration. The second sensing RS configuration is determined by the apparatus or is received from another apparatus in an event that at least one of a sensing requirement and a channel condition is changed. The apparatus may further perform the sensing of the target object based on the second RSs.
